Plumbing relocation services involve moving existing plumbing systems to different areas within a property or installing new plumbing lines to accommodate renovations or expansions. This process typically includes disconnecting current pipes, rerouting or extending plumbing lines, and reconnecting them securely to ensure proper function. Skilled service providers handle all aspects of the work, ensuring that the new plumbing setup meets the property’s needs and functions reliably. Plumbing relocation is essential when a property owner wants to change the layout of kitchens, bathrooms, or laundry rooms, or when structural modifications require repositioning of plumbing fixtures.
These services help resolve common problems such as outdated or damaged pipes that no longer meet the demands of the property, or the need to eliminate awkward or inefficient plumbing layouts. Moving plumbing can also address issues caused by remodeling projects that require fixtures to be relocated to more convenient or accessible locations. Additionally, plumbing relocation can prevent future leaks or water damage by replacing old pipes during the process. Service providers can also assist with rerouting plumbing to improve water pressure or to accommodate new appliances and fixtures, ensuring the plumbing system functions smoothly after changes are made.

The overview below groups typical Plumbing Relocation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- typical costs for minor plumbing relocations, such as moving a few fixtures or rerouting pipes, generally range from $250 to $600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, with fewer projects reaching the higher end of the spectrum.
Medium-Scale Projects - relocating plumbing for a bathroom or kitchen can cost between $1,000 and $3,000 depending on the complexity. These projects are common and often involve rerouting existing lines or installing new fixtures.
Full Room or Multiple Fixture Moves - larger relocations that involve extensive pipe rerouting or multiple fixtures typically cost between $3,500 and $7,000. Such projects are less frequent but are necessary for significant renovations or redesigns.
Complete System Replacements - comprehensive plumbing relocations, including replacing old pipes and fixtures throughout a property, can exceed $10,000, with larger, more complex projects reaching $20,000 or more. These are less common and usually involve extensive planning and labor.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
